Overview of STED

STED (Systematic Thermal Energy Design) is specialized in guiding users through the design, analysis, and optimization of thermal energy systems such as furnaces, boilers, and heat pumps. Its core purpose is to enhance the efficiency, performance, and sustainability of these systems. STED assists in detailed calculations of energy efficiency, suggests design and operational improvements, and helps in drafting detailed manufacturing and operational specifications. For example, in the context of designing a new industrial boiler, STED could analyze heat transfer rates, fuel consumption, and emissions to recommend the most efficient design and material choices. Core Functions of STED

  • Energy Efficiency Analysis

    Example Example

    For a residential heating system using a heat pump, STED would calculate the Seasonal Performance Factor (SPF) and suggest measures to improve it, such as integrating solar thermal panels.

    Example Scenario

    This function is crucial when users aim to optimize operational costs and reduce environmental impact in residential or commercial buildings.

  • Design Improvement Suggestions

    Example Example

    In upgrading an aging furnace in a metal processing plant, STED could recommend advanced insulation materials and burner upgrades to enhance heat retention and reduce energy consumption.

    Example Scenario

    This function helps in retrofitting older systems to meet modern efficiency standards, thus extending the system's life and improving performance.

  • Drafting Manufacturing Specifications

    Example Example

    For a new line of eco-friendly boilers, STED would provide detailed specifications on materials, design standards, and compliance with environmental regulations.

    Example Scenario

    This function is essential for manufacturers aiming to launch new products that meet specific market needs and regulatory standards.
